Singularities of low entropy high codimension curve shortening flow
Published 5 Apr 2023 in math.DG and math.AP | (2304.02487v1)
Abstract: We consider curve shortening flow of arbitrary codimension in an Euclidean background. We show that, close to a singularity, the flow is asymptotically planar, paralleling Altschuler's work in the case of space curves, and analyse the blow-up limits of the flow. Using these results, we then prove that the curve shortening flow of initial curves with an entropy bound converges to a round point in finite time.
